What is a starfish's foodchain?

Starfish are carnivorous animals, some are predators, others are detritivores.

What is a starfishs class?

Starfish belongs to the phylum echinodermata, subphylum asterozoa, class asteroidea.


What is the relationship between a foodchain and trophic level?

A foodchain shows the feeding relationships of organisms from successive trophic levels.
